Officer Judy Hopp has a case to crack, and nothing will stand in her way — nothing that is, except for a super-slow sloth at the local DMV.

In the trailer for Disney’s Zootopia, audiences are introduced to Officer Judy Hopp (Ginnifer Goodwin), an enthusiastic, bright-eyed bunny eager for her big break. When she volunteers for a major case — with sneaky weasel Duke Weaselton at the heart of the crime — she immediately sets to work. With smart-aleck Nick Wild (Jason Bateman) by her side, Officer Hopp heads to the DMV — otherwise known as the Department of Mammal Vehicles — for some scoop on a license plate she suspects is connected to the felony.

With just 48 hours to solve the case, Officer Hopp needs all the help she can get from the DMV’s best and brightest employees. Unfortunately for her, she gets stuck with Flash (Raymond S. Persi), a character who doesn’t exactly live up to his name but definitely fulfills every scary DMV stereotype, ever.

Directed by Byron Howard and Rich Moore, and featuring adorable, animated mammals voiced by Idris Elba, J.K. Simmons, Alan Tudyk, Katie Lowes, Jenny Slate, Octavia Spencer, Bonnie Hunt, Tommy Chong, and Shakira, Zootopia hops into theaters March 4, 2016.
